Roles and Responsibilities of UP Police

The UP Police plays a crucial role in maintaining public safety and enforcing the law. Some of its primary responsibilities include:

Crime Prevention

The UP Police actively engage in community policing initiatives aimed at preventing crime before it occurs. This involves:

  • Creating awareness programs
  • Engaging with community members
  • Collaborating with local organizations

Law Enforcement

UP Police is responsible for enforcing laws, conducting investigations, and apprehending criminals. Their extensive training equips them to handle various situations, from domestic disputes to serious criminal cases effectively.

Traffic Management

Given the high traffic density in urban areas, the UP Police also manages road safety. Their duties include:

  • Monitoring traffic flow
  • Enforcing traffic laws
  • Educating the public on road safety

Emergency Response

UP Police is often the first responders to emergencies, including natural disasters and public disturbances. They are trained to act decisively and efficiently under pressure to protect lives and property.

Community Policing Initiatives

The UP Police recognizes the importance of building trust and cooperation with the communities they serve. Community policing initiatives aim to foster healthy relationships between law enforcement and citizens. These programs include:

  • Neighborhood Watch: Encouraging residents to monitor local activities and report suspicious behavior.
  • Public Meetings: Regular forums for citizens to express concerns and suggestions about local safety.
  • School Programs: Educating youth about traffic rules, personal safety, and community roles in preventing crime.

These initiatives not only enhance public trust but also promote a shared responsibility for maintaining law and order in the community.

Training and Recruitment

To maintain high standards in law enforcement, the UP Police places a strong emphasis on training and recruitment. The recruitment process is rigorous, ensuring that only the most qualified candidates join the force.

Selection Process

The selection process for UP Police includes:

  • Written exams
  • Physical fitness tests
  • Interview rounds

Successful candidates undergo extensive training that covers:

  • Legal knowledge
  • Investigative techniques
  • Community engagement skills.

Ongoing training programs ensure that personnel stay updated on new laws, technology, and best practices in policing.
